Location and Transport Accessibility of Tien Hotel

Tien Hotel is situated in the bustling Georgetown area of Penang, a UNESCO World Heritage Site renowned for its rich history, colonial architecture, and incredible street art. Located at 348, Lebuh Chulia, Georgetown, Pulau Pinang, Penang, Malaysia, 10200, the hotel is perfectly positioned for exploring the best of what Penang has to offer. You'll find yourself within easy reach of vibrant local cafes, bustling street food stalls, and charming heritage buildings. The city centre is just a short distance away, and while Penang is well-served by public transport, many of the key attractions are within comfortable walking distance. For those looking to venture further, the nearest public transport links are readily accessible, making it easy to navigate the island. If you're planning a road trip to explore more of Penang's scenic beauty, car rental options are also available nearby, and parking information can be obtained directly from the hotel.

Popular Attractions and Activities near Tien Hotel

Penang is a treasure trove of cultural, historical, and natural attractions, and Tien Hotel serves as an excellent starting point for your adventures. Within easy reach, you can explore the vibrant street art of Georgetown, wander through the historic Clan Jetties, and visit iconic landmarks like the Khoo Kongsi. For a dose of nature and stunning views, a trip up Penang Hill is highly recommended. The beautiful beaches of Batu Ferringhi are also accessible for a day of sun and sea. Immerse yourself in the local culture at the colourful Little India or explore the serene Kek Lok Si Temple. As announced by Royal Malaysian Customs Department, Tourism Tax is imposed starting 1 January 2023 for all hotel guests that are non-Malaysian or non-permanent Residents of Malaysia. Please expect that hotel will collect the Tourism Tax from you during check-in at the hotel. The Tourism Tax rate is 10 RM per room per night.
